Word itself is not scanning software so you will first need a scanner and scanning software. If a document is properly scanned, then Word can edit it. It needs to be scanned as text, not as a graphic. So it is important to ensure you have not scanned it like a photo. Use the OCR or text mode with the scanner software.Word itself is not scanning software so you will first need a scanner and scanning software. When you are scanning text, you have to make sure you scan it in text mode or what is sometimes called OCR mode. Otherwise it is just scanning your text like a picture, so it is basically a photo of it, so it cannot be edited. Check your user manual for your scanner and you will find how to get it to scan just text in a way that it can be edited.

Yes, scanning pictures is different from scanning Word documents, mainly in purpose, output, and settings. When you scan pictures (photos, images, artwork), the goal is to capture visual quality. Scanners focus on higher resolution (DPI), color accuracy, and detail. The output is usually an image file like JPG, PNG, or TIFF, and it is not meant to be edited as text. When you scan Word documents or text documents, the goal is readability and editability. The scanner may use lower or standard resolution, and the output is often a PDF or editable format using OCR (Optical Character Recognition). OCR converts printed text into editable digital text so you can modify it in Word or other software. In short: Photos → image quality focus Documents → text clarity and editability focus So yes, the process settings and final output are quite different depending on what you are scanning.

You should find scanners that offer the ability to scan to PDF. You should also look for a scanner that is an OCR scanner. Frist, of course, be sure that it is compatible with your computer. Secondly, it if supports TWAIN you will get more life out of the model as even when they stop writing driver for it your system should still be able to access it. Finally, a scanner with a removable lid is great for scanning oversized books, maps etc.
OCR is Optical Character Recognition. It is for scanning printed text. That could be from a word processor, but also from any well printed text, like from a typewriter. Even very carefully written text can be scanned if the writing is of block characters. So OCR is not exclusively from word processed documents.
